Introduction to Mahjong

Originating in China during the Qing dynasty, Mahjong is traditionally played with four players and involves a set of 144 tiles. These tiles are adorned with Chinese characters and symbols that represent different suits and values. Players aim to create the best possible hand by drawing and discarding tiles, akin to the game of rummy.

The game began to spread beyond China’s borders in the early 20th century, with its popularity skyrocketing in the United States during the 1920s. Despite some variations in rules and gameplay across different cultures, the core essence of Mahjong remains untouched. Today, it is celebrated globally, both as a social activity among friends and family and as a competitive sport.

The Rules of Mahjong

Mahjong is played with the objective of forming a complete hand, which typically consists of four sets and a pair, making up a total of 14 tiles. A standard set can be a 'pong' (three identical tiles), a 'chow' (three consecutive tiles of the same suit), or a 'kong' (four identical tiles).

Players draw tiles to form these sets while also trying to disrupt their opponents' strategies by discarding tiles that are less beneficial to their own hand or that could potentially benefit others. Observing opponents' moves and adapting strategies are crucial skills in mastering Mahjong.

Mahjong Variations

For example, American Mahjong introduces the use of jokers and a unique scoring card that changes annually, adding extra layers of complexity and excitement. Japanese Riichi, on the other hand, incorporates the concept of 'declaring riichi,' a strategic move signifying the completion of a player's hand under specific conditions.
